Get Backend API for Online Food Ordering Solution Using React Js

Start with the online food ordering solution using react js frontend, which is free and open-source. To unlock the backend API, schedule a call with our sales team. Documentation and real-world examples are provided.

On demand white label delivery solution

Frequently Asked Questions

The food ordering application is managed using React by creating dynamic, component-based user interfaces that update in real-time based on user interactions and data changes, enhancing the overall user experience. State management libraries like Redux or Context API can be used to efficiently manage application state across components.

Yes, the software is typically designed to be compatible with modern web browsers (like Chrome, Firefox, Safari, and Edge) and mobile devices. Key aspects include: Responsive Design: The user interface is built with responsive design principles, ensuring it adapts to various screen sizes and orientations. Cross-Browser Compatibility: The application is tested across major browsers to ensure consistent functionality and appearance. Progressive Web App (PWA) Features: If implemented, PWA features allow the application to function smoothly on mobile devices, providing offline access and improved performance. Mobile-Friendly Interfaces: Touch-friendly elements enhance usability on smartphones and tablets.

React.js is preferred for developing modern food delivery and ordering platforms for several reasons: Component-Based Architecture: React's modular design allows for reusable components, making it easier to manage and scale the application. Dynamic User Interfaces: React efficiently updates and renders components, providing a smooth and responsive user experience, crucial for real-time order updates. Virtual DOM: React's use of a virtual DOM optimizes rendering performance, ensuring fast UI updates without unnecessary re-renders. Strong Community and Ecosystem: A large community and rich ecosystem of libraries and tools support rapid development and problem-solving. Flexibility: React can be easily integrated with other libraries and frameworks, allowing for customization and enhancing functionality. State Management: Libraries like Redux or Context API facilitate effective state management, crucial for handling complex data interactions in food ordering systems. SEO-Friendly: With server-side rendering options, React can improve SEO performance, making it easier for users to find the platform.

Common technologies used alongside React to complete a food delivery and ordering system include: Node.js: A JavaScript runtime for building the server-side logic and handling API requests. Express.js: A web framework for Node.js that simplifies routing and middleware management. MongoDB: A NoSQL database for storing data such as user profiles, orders, and restaurant information. Redux: A state management library that helps manage application state, especially in larger applications with complex data flows. Socket.IO: For real-time communication, enabling instant updates for order statuses and notifications. Axios or Fetch API: For making HTTP requests to interact with the backend API. CSS Frameworks: Libraries like Bootstrap or Tailwind CSS for styling and responsive design. Webpack: A module bundler for optimizing the application's assets and improving performance. Jest or React Testing Library: For testing components and ensuring application reliability.

×

DeliverXpress Customer

DeliverXpress Restaurant

DeliverXpress Rider

DeliverXpress Web

DeliverXpress Admin